Table 1.
Baseline Characteristics of Those Who Developed Corneal Perforation or Underwent Therapeutic Penetrating Keratoplasty
| TPK (n = 122) | No TPK (n = 118) | OR (95% CI) | P Valuea | |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Sex, No. (%)b | ||||
| Male | 70 (57.9) | 65 (55.5) | 0.94 (0.56–1.57) | .82 |
| Female | 51 (42.1) | 52 (44.4) | ||
| Age, median (IQR), y | 53.5 (42–63) | 51.5 (45–60) | 1.01 (0.99–1.03) | .31 |
| Occupation, No. (%) | ||||
| Agriculture | 64 (52.5) | 77 (65.3) | 0.59 (0.35–0.99) | .045c |
| Nonagricultured | 58 (47.5) | 41 (34.7) | ||
| Trauma/injury, No. (%) | 53 (43.4) | 63 (53.4) | 0.98 (0.77–1.24) | .88 |
| Vegetative matter/wood | 36 (29.5) | 38 (32.2) | ||
| Metal/othere | 27 (22.1) | 37 (31.4) | ||
| Unknown object | 2 (1.6) | 4 (3.4) | ||
| Affected eye, No. (%) | ||||
| Right | 80 (65.5) | 59 (50.0) | 0.80 (0.53–1.21) | .29 |
| Visual acuity, logMAR, median (IQR) | 1.7 (1.70–1.80) | 1.66 (1.22–1.80) | 1.17 (1.08–1.27) | <.001c |
| Infiltrate/Scar, median (IQR), mmf | 6.07 (5.00–6.94) | 5.00 (4.90–5.92) | 1.51 (1.26–1.81) | <.001c |
| Hypopyon, No. (%), mm | ||||
| No | 22 (18.3) | 43 (37.7) | 2.70 (1.52–4.82) | .001c |
| <0.5 | 19 (15.8) | 20 (17.5) | ||
| ≥0.5 | 79 (65.8) | 51 (44.7) | ||
| % of Depth, No. (%) | ||||
| >0–33 | 18 (15.0) | 40 (33.9) | 2.25 (1.56–3.24) | <.001c |
| >33–67 | 46 (38.3) | 56 (47.5) | ||
| >67–100 | 55 (45.8) | 22 (18.6) | ||
| Epithelial defect, median (IQR), mmf | 5.02 (3.88–6.08) | 4.36 (3.07–5.23) | 1.23 (1.06–1.42) | .005c |
| Organism | ||||
| Fusarium | 42 | 30 | 1.05 (0.83–1.34) | .69 |
| Aspergillus | 31 | 32 | ||
| Other | 31 | 30 | ||
| Duration of symptoms, median (IQR), d | 10.00 (7.00–15.00) | 9.50 (5.00–15.25) | 0.99 (0.97–1.02) | .56 |
| Systemic disease, No. (%)g | 9 (7.4) | 17 (14.4) | 0.47 (0.20–1.10) | .09 |
Abbreviations: IQR, interquartile range; OR, odds ratio; TPK, therapeutic penetrating keratoplasty.
Univariate analysis to determine whether baseline characteristic predicts the development of corneal perforation or the need for therapeutic penetrating keratoplasty.
Two patients were missing values for sex.
Statistically significant difference in univariate analysis and added to multivariate logistic regression model.
Includes unemployed and retired.
Includes dust, battery acid, ash, cement, fingernail, stick, cow or buffalo tail, goat horn, and insect.
Geometric mean of the longest diameter and longest perpendicular to that diameter in millimeters.
Includes diabetes mellitus, asthma, and hypertension.
